Laboratory pollution prevention and treatment should comply with relevant national laws and regulations, and for the use of explosive, toxic, biologically hazardous and polluting substances Laboratory planning. When planning a system laboratory, it should comply with relevant regulations on safety, protection, evacuation, and environmental protection.
1. Laboratory waste liquid treatment
The treatment of laboratory waste liquids adopts different methods according to the nature, composition, etc., and the laboratory planning company should adopt separate collection methods for different types of waste liquids, and it is strictly forbidden to discharge the waste liquids directly. The laboratory should separate and collect inorganic waste liquid, organic waste liquid, and highly toxic waste liquid, and make relevant labels to prevent mixing, avoid chemical reactions between wastes, and perform simple acid-base neutralization. Record, transfer the collected waste liquid to a transfer station, and periodically transfer it to a qualified waste liquid treatment institution for treatment. The waste liquid barrel is generally acid and alkali-resistant high-density polyethylene waste liquid barrel. It is forbidden to mix waste liquids that are not of different categories or that may cause abnormal reactions.
The monitoring method standards of some projects promulgated and implemented in recent years have made simple requirements for waste disposal, such as the "Pressurized Fluid Extraction Method for the Extraction of Soil and Sediment Organic Matter" HJ 783-2016 requires "Experiments in Waste Disposal Hazardous wastes such as organic waste liquids should be stored separately, kept in a centralized manner, and sent to qualified units for disposal". The "Spectrophotometric Method for the Determination of Soil Cyanide and Total Cyanide" HJ 745-2015 requires that the waste liquid generated in the experiment should be collected and clearly marked in the waste disposal. For example, the poisonous waste liquid (cyanide) is entrusted with Qualified unit processing.

2. Laboratory waste gas treatment
Laboratory waste gas is mainly divided into two categories, acid mist and organic gas. The operations that produce the two types of pollution should be carried out in different fume hoods, and the generated waste gas should be treated by the waste gas treatment device before being discharged.
Note: Acid mist gas should be absorbed and treated with alkaline aqueous solution, and organic waste gas should be treated with high-efficiency absorption device.
3. Laboratory solid waste treatment
For highly toxic soluble solid waste, special containers should be set up to collect them separately during laboratory planning. Other solid waste can be treated in accordance with relevant national laws and regulations, specifically in accordance with the "General Industrial Solid Waste Storage Control Standard" GB 18599 and other relevant national regulations.
